    408 Cam on the way

    I have a 408 stroker in the works. I went with a re-ground cam. Saves cash at around $150 plus shipping vs $350 for new, plus I can reuse my distributor gear. Here are the specs from Ken at Oregon Cam Grinders #1357 230/236 @ .050”, 284/290 adc, .515”/.515” lift (1.6:1 rocker), 108 sep As you...

    340 block value?

    In my research for building a 5.9 into a 408 stroker, I read that the 340 is a preferred production engine for a stroker build due to its large bore and thick walls that can take a .040 overbore to make a 418 stroker. This reference (How to Build Big-Inch Mopar Small Blocks) suggests that...
